Counties

The Puget Sound AVA covers 12 counties:

  • Clallam
  • Island
  • Jefferson
  • King
  • Kitsap
  • Mason
  • Pierce
  • San Juan
  • Skagit
  • Snohomish
  • Thurston
  • Whatcom
